Critical value:
The critical value can be obtained using the MINITAB software.
Statistical procedure:
The step by step procedure to find the critical-value using the MINITAB software is given below:
- Select Graphs, then Click on View probability>click ok.
- Under Distribution, choose Chi-square.
- Enter degrees of freedom as 17.
- Under shaded area, select Define shaded area by Probability-value.
- Enter the Probability-value as 0.05.
- Select right tail and click OK.
The output obtained by MINITAB is given below:
From the MINITAB output, it can be seen that the critical value is 27.59
